Merge branch 'jk/shortlog-no-wrap-doc' into maint
authorJunio C Hamano <gitster@pobox.com>
Mon, 14 Jan 2013 15:59:03 +0000 (07:59 -0800)
committerJunio C Hamano <gitster@pobox.com>
Mon, 14 Jan 2013 15:59:03 +0000 (07:59 -0800)
* jk/shortlog-no-wrap-doc:
git-shortlog(1): document behaviour of zero-width wrap

1  2 
Documentation/git-shortlog.txt
index afeb4cdf16df91f63197d390fdbf1540eff66837,804c84d18404d6a9e5eb8fbc89d8b3a34735f43f..c308e91537a02817560d3108be5517d1806b0c9e
@@@ -3,26 -3,22 +3,26 @@@ git-shortlog(1
  
  NAME
  ----
 -git-shortlog - Summarize 'git-log' output
 +git-shortlog - Summarize 'git log' output
  
  SYNOPSIS
  --------
  [verse]
  git log --pretty=short | 'git shortlog' [-h] [-n] [-s] [-e] [-w]
 -git shortlog [-n|--numbered] [-s|--summary] [-e|--email] [-w[<width>[,<indent1>[,<indent2>]]]] [<committish>...]
 +'git shortlog' [-n|--numbered] [-s|--summary] [-e|--email] [-w[<width>[,<indent1>[,<indent2>]]]] <commit>...
  
  DESCRIPTION
  -----------
 -Summarizes 'git-log' output in a format suitable for inclusion
 -in release announcements. Each commit will be grouped by author and
 -the first line of the commit message will be shown.
 +Summarizes 'git log' output in a format suitable for inclusion
 +in release announcements. Each commit will be grouped by author and title.
  
  Additionally, "[PATCH]" will be stripped from the commit description.
  
 +If no revisions are passed on the command line and either standard input
 +is not a terminal or there is no current branch, 'git shortlog' will
 +output a summary of the log read from standard input, without
 +reference to the current repository.
 +
  OPTIONS
  -------
  
  --email::
        Show the email address of each author.
  
 +--format[=<format>]::
 +      Instead of the commit subject, use some other information to
 +      describe each commit.  '<format>' can be any string accepted
 +      by the `--format` option of 'git log', such as '* [%h] %s'.
 +      (See the "PRETTY FORMATS" section of linkgit:git-log[1].)
 +
 +      Each pretty-printed commit will be rewrapped before it is shown.
 +
  -w[<width>[,<indent1>[,<indent2>]]]::
        Linewrap the output by wrapping each line at `width`.  The first
        line of each entry is indented by `indent1` spaces, and the second
        and subsequent lines are indented by `indent2` spaces. `width`,
        `indent1`, and `indent2` default to 76, 6 and 9 respectively.
+ +
+ If width is `0` (zero) then indent the lines of the output without wrapping
+ them.
  
  
  MAPPING AUTHORS
@@@ -67,6 -58,15 +70,6 @@@ spelled differently
  
  include::mailmap.txt[]
  
 -
 -Author
 -------
 -Written by Jeff Garzik <jgarzik@pobox.com>
 -
 -Documentation
 ---------------
 -Documentation by Junio C Hamano.
 -
  GIT
  ---
  Part of the linkgit:git[1] suite